The essentials\nBriivue’s 36x30 inch LED bathroom mirror combines front and back lighting to provide bright, even illumination for grooming tasks. The dual-light design aims to help with makeup, shaving, and daily routines, while the built-in defogger keeps the reflective surface clear in steamy bathrooms.\n\n## What matters most\nIf you prioritize customizable light, this mirror offers color temperatures of 3000K, 4000K, and 6000K with dimming from 10% to 100%. The memory function saves your preferred brightness and color, so your setup is ready with a single switch. The tempered glass is designed to be shatter-resistant, and an epoxy coating adds durability in damp environments.\n\n## Pros and cons in practice\nPros: bright, versatile lighting suitable for makeup and daily routines, anti-fog helps maintain visibility, memory function simplifies daily use, sturdy tempered glass with corrosion-resistant coating.\nCons: you may want to verify your installation method (plug-in vs. hardwired) to ensure compatibility with existing wiring, the blue indicator lights on the defogger can be a minor distraction for some users.\n\n## Who it’s for\nThis mirror suits bathrooms where wall space allows a horizontal installation and users who value adjustable color temperature and dimming.
